Abstract
The invention discloses a rotating connection joint with a fastening control device and a folding rod set. The rotating connection joint comprises two joint seats, a button and an elastic body, wherein the first joint seat and the second joint seat are connected in a pivot mode, and the pivot joint axial line of the first joint seat and the second joint seat is an axial line X. The button comprises a button part and a locking part, the button is connected to the first joint seat in a pivot mode and rotates between a locking position and an unlocking position, and the elastic body butts between the first joint seat and the button to enable the button to receive torsion from the unlocking position to the locking position. The button part and the locking part are fixedly connected and are of a V-shaped structure, and a protrusion is arranged on the side face, facing the button part, of the locking part in a protruding mode. The second joint seat is provided with an arc-shaped wall around the axial line X, a groove is formed in the arc-shaped wall in a concaving mode, and the protrusion located at the locking position is inserted into the groove. The rotating connection joint with the fastening control device has the advantages of being compact in structure, convenient to operate and assemble, flexible in locating, capable of preventing fingers from being clamped, high in safety, large in locking strength, good in fastening effect.
